IP Lookup ResultSnapshotNotice: data is being updated, so some fields may be inaccurate.IP Address223.26.64.66PingTracerouteLocation China,TaiwanCorrectASNNot availableASN OwnerIDC--CompanyIDC--Longitude121.578Latitude25.0735IP TypeResidentialProxy IPWhy Datacenter?Native IPNative IPWhy Roaming IP?Risk ScoreIP Address (Decimal)3743039554
Recent IP Lookups216.157.138.25580.102.3.190131.0.109.19079.180.140.11216.205.23.24027.147.192.98155.131.12.191193.228.41.234103.67.232.188223.26.64.6680.85.138.252140.147.237.252213.111.131.19441.70.64.8663.210.57.12178.17.71.167.218.32.212401:d800:2488:9625:6d32:1521:3616:f5a023.45.9.131104.100.0.61223.26.64.65223.26.64.67